It is sad that Bob Villa is pushing these now (Amish type heaters). When my wife worked for the power company she would have people call up and complain that their electric bill went up and their new heater said it would reduce their heating bills.... Yes, it will heat a room, so you can turn down your furnace, but the heat still comes from the electricity, which you are now increasing the amount you use. I like the idea of a small space heater but I won't pay $300 for something that can be made for $20.
